Thank you for your request dated Jan 08, 2022 01:04:15 AM under Executive Order No. 2 (s. 2016) on Freedom of Information in the Executive Branch. Your request You asked for Crypto Scam through Facebook Page. Response to your request To file formal complaints, please personally report to ACG Headquarters in Camp Crame, Quezon City or to the Regional Anti-Cybercrime Unit (RACU). Your right to request a review If you are unhappy with this response to your FOI request, you may ask us to carry out an internal review of the response by writing to. Your review request should explain why you are dissatisfied with this response, and should be made within 15 calendar days from the date when you received this letter. We will complete the review and tell you the result within 30 calendar days from the date when we receive your review request. If you are not satisfied with the result of the review, you then have the right to appeal to the Office of the President under Administrative Order No. 22 (s. 2011). Thank you.
